Well, the talent pool is getting thinner all over the Mid-Atlantic region.  I count 27 colleges and universities in NC now playing 4-year football and a few more in southern Virginia that are taking players we used to recruit.  I also hear there are a few more like Lees-McRae and Brevard that may jump back into the fray plus several others such as High Point University that are considering teams again after absences of over a half century.  Looks to me as though you either have to expand your recruiting base or settle for less talented players ...

Pat Cummings - enjoy your regional update each week.  Thanks for putting this together.  Question about your comment regarding the 3rd tiebreaker in USAC.  Does this tiebreaker take non-conference games into consideration?  You mentioned that the only common opponents were in conference but:

CNU & Methodist both played Salisbury (both lost)
CNU & Ferrum both played Chowan (both won)  - (does a non d3 count?)
Methodist & Ferrum both played E&H (both won)
Methodist & Ferrum both played Guilford (both won)

Since there is no advantage for any of the three teams in these results - this is moot in terms of determining a tiebreaker this season.  But just wondering how this might play out if just one non-conference result above was different?
